Four
Swedish animal rights activists from Umeå arrested following a raid
on the mink farm in Umgransele in the spring of 2009 have been sentenced
to ommunity service. The three women and one man were arrested in a car
with false plates and investigations proved that they had been inside the
mink farm. At the trial it was revealed that the operation was well planned,
but none of the defendants would answer the prosecutor's questions. In addition
to community service for 75 days, they were also sentenced to pay damages
of more than SEK 20 000 (£1,700) to the owner of the mink farm.
